2024年深度学习资料_第1页
2024年深度学习资料_第2页
2024年深度学习资料_第3页
2024年深度学习资料_第4页
2024年深度学习资料_第5页
已阅读5页,还剩26页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2024年深度学习资料汇报人:XX2024-02-04XXREPORTING目录深度学习概述与发展趋势神经网络模型与算法介绍计算机视觉领域应用探讨自然语言处理领域应用实践语音识别与合成技术研究强化学习在深度学习中应用数据集、工具和资源推荐PART01深度学习概述与发展趋势REPORTINGXX深度学习定义深度学习是机器学习的一个分支,通过构建具有多层隐藏层的神经网络模型来学习数据的复杂特征和规律。基本原理深度学习利用神经网络中的大量神经元和连接,通过前向传播和反向传播算法,不断调整网络参数以拟合训练数据,并实现对新数据的预测和分类等任务。深度学习定义及基本原理深度学习经历了从早期的感知机模型到现代深度神经网络的演变,得益于计算能力的提升和大数据的驱动,深度学习在语音识别、图像识别、自然语言处理等领域取得了显著成果。发展历程目前,深度学习已成为人工智能领域的研究热点,广泛应用于计算机视觉、智能语音、自然语言处理、推荐系统等多个领域。同时,深度学习也面临着模型可解释性差、数据隐私和安全等挑战。现状分析发展历程及现状分析未来趋势未来深度学习将更加注重模型的可解释性和泛化能力,推动人工智能技术的可持续发展。同时,深度学习将与强化学习、迁移学习等技术相结合,形成更加智能的机器学习系统。挑战在实现深度学习广泛应用的过程中,需要解决模型复杂度与计算资源之间的矛盾,提高模型的训练效率和推理速度。此外,还需要关注数据隐私和安全问题,保护用户数据不被滥用和泄露。未来趋势与挑战PART02神经网络模型与算法介绍REPORTINGXX适用于图像识别、自然语言处理等任务,通过卷积层提取局部特征。卷积神经网络(CNN)用于处理序列数据,如语音识别、机器翻译等,具有记忆功能。循环神经网络(RNN)通过生成器和判别器的对抗训练,生成具有高度真实感的图像、音频等。生成对抗网络(GAN)由多个受限玻尔兹曼机堆叠而成,可用于特征提取和分类任务。深度信念网络(DBN)常见神经网络模型概述前向传播与反向传播梯度下降优化算法正则化技术学习率调整策略算法原理及优化方法神经网络通过前向传播计算输出,通过反向传播调整权重。如L1正则化、L2正则化等,用于防止过拟合。包括批量梯度下降、随机梯度下降和小批量梯度下降等。如固定学习率、学习率衰减等,有助于提高训练效果。应用场景与案例分析神经网络在图像分类、目标检测、人脸识别等领域具有广泛应用。用于文本分类、情感分析、机器翻译等任务,取得了显著成果。神经网络在语音识别和语音合成方面取得了重要突破。利用神经网络挖掘用户兴趣和行为模式,为用户提供个性化推荐。计算机视觉自然语言处理语音识别与合成推荐系统PART03计算机视觉领域应用探讨REPORTINGXX

图像分类与目标检测技术图像分类技术包括基于卷积神经网络(CNN)的分类方法、迁移学习在图像分类中的应用、细粒度图像分类技术等。目标检测技术涉及基于区域的目标检测算法(如R-CNN系列)、基于回归的目标检测算法(如YOLO、SSD等)、目标检测中的锚框与无锚框方法等。评估指标与优化方法介绍目标检测任务中常用的评估指标(如准确率、召回率、F1分数等),以及优化目标检测性能的方法,如多尺度训练、数据增强等。实例分割方法介绍基于区域的实例分割算法(如MaskR-CNN)、基于轮廓的实例分割算法(如DeepSnake等),以及实例分割在特定场景下的应用。语义分割技术探讨全卷积网络(FCN)在语义分割中的应用、U-Net等经典语义分割网络结构,以及条件随机场(CRF)等后处理技术。评估指标与挑战分析实例分割任务中常用的评估指标(如平均精度、平均召回率等),并讨论当前实例分割面临的挑战和未来发展趋势。语义分割与实例分割方法视频处理及时序分析技术视频处理基础介绍视频编解码技术、视频帧间预测与补偿方法等视频处理基础知识。行为识别与视频理解介绍基于时序分析的行为识别方法,如C3D、I3D等网络结构,并讨论视频理解任务中的关键技术,如视频问答、视频摘要生成等。时序分析技术探讨基于循环神经网络(RNN)和长短时记忆网络(LSTM)的时序分析方法,以及基于3D卷积神经网络的视频特征提取技术。评估指标与数据集分析视频处理及时序分析任务中常用的评估指标(如准确率、帧率等),并介绍常用的视频处理数据集及其特点。PART04自然语言处理领域应用实践REPORTINGXX包括词袋模型、TF-IDF、Word2Vec、GloVe等,用于将文本转换为计算机可理解的数值形式。文本表示方法通过训练将词语映射到高维空间中,捕捉词语间的语义关系,提高文本处理效果。词向量技术利用大规模语料库进行预训练,得到通用的语言表示模型,可应用于多种NLP任务。预训练语言模型文本表示与词向量技术123基于文本内容,识别情感倾向(积极、消极、中立)及情感强度,用于产品评论、社交媒体等场景。情感分析包括基于模板、基于规则、基于神经网络等方法,用于生成新闻报道、对话回复、摘要等文本内容。文本生成方法如循环神经网络(RNN)、长短期记忆网络(LSTM)、生成对抗网络(GAN)等,在文本生成领域具有广泛应用。深度学习模型情感分析及文本生成方法利用深度学习技术实现自动翻译,包括神经机器翻译(NMT)、统计机器翻译(SMT)等方法,支持多种语言对翻译。机器翻译包括任务导向型对话系统和闲聊型对话系统,前者用于完成特定任务(如订票、查询信息),后者用于与用户进行自由交流。对话系统实现涉及自然语言理解、对话管理、自然语言生成等技术,以及知识图谱、强化学习等方法在对话系统中的应用。对话系统技术机器翻译及对话系统实现PART05语音识别与合成技术研究REPORTINGXX语音识别基本原理及挑战语音识别基本原理语音识别是将声音信号转化为文字或指令的过程,其基本原理包括信号预处理、特征提取、声学模型、语言模型和解码搜索等步骤。语音识别面临的挑战在实际应用中,语音识别面临着多种挑战,如背景噪声干扰、口音和方言差异、说话速度和语调变化等,这些因素都会影响语音识别的准确率和稳定性。语音合成方法及优化策略语音合成是将文字转化为声音信号的过程,其方法包括基于规则的合成、拼接合成和基于深度学习的合成等。其中,基于深度学习的语音合成方法具有更好的自然度和灵活性。语音合成方法为了提高语音合成的自然度和清晰度,可以采取多种优化策略,如增加语音数据集的多样性和规模、优化声学模型和语言模型的结构和参数、使用更先进的神经网络结构等。语音合成优化策略多模态交互系统概述多模态交互系统是指能够同时处理多种模态信息的系统,如语音、文字、图像等。这种系统可以为用户提供更加自然和便捷的人机交互体验。多模态交互系统设计思路在设计多模态交互系统时,需要考虑多种因素,如不同模态信息之间的融合方式、用户界面的友好性和易用性、系统的实时性和稳定性等。同时,还需要根据具体应用场景和用户需求来定制系统的功能和特点。多模态交互系统设计思路PART06强化学习在深度学习中应用REPORTINGXX03学习过程强化学习通过不断试错来学习最优策略,使得智能体能够获得最大的累积奖励。01强化学习定义强化学习是一种通过智能体在与环境交互过程中学习决策策略的机器学习方法。02基本要素包括智能体、环境、状态、动作、奖励等,其中智能体根据当前状态选择动作,环境给出新的状态和奖励。强化学习基本原理介绍DQN算法DQN(DeepQ-Network)算法将深度学习与Q-Learning结合,通过神经网络来逼近Q值函数,实现了对高维状态空间的处理。PolicyGradient算法PolicyGradient算法直接对策略进行更新,通过梯度上升来最大化期望回报,适用于连续动作空间的问题。Actor-Critic算法Actor-Critic算法结合了值函数逼近和策略梯度的优势,通过Actor网络输出动作,Critic网络评估值函数,实现了更高效的学习。深度强化学习算法剖析游戏AI01深度强化学习在游戏AI领域取得了显著成果,如AlphaGo、AlphaStar等,通过自我对弈和学习人类棋谱等方式,实现了超越人类的水平。自动驾驶02自动驾驶是深度强化学习的另一个重要应用领域,通过训练智能体学习驾驶策略,实现了在复杂交通环境下的自动驾驶功能。其他领域03深度强化学习还在医疗、金融、能源等领域得到了广泛应用,如医疗影像分析、股票交易决策、智能电网控制等。游戏AI和自动驾驶等案例分析PART07数据集、工具和资源推荐REPORTINGXX使用方法这些数据集通常可以从官方网站或学术研究机构获取,下载后需要按照相应的格式进行预处理和标注,然后才能用于训练深度学习模型。ImageNet用于视觉对象识别研究的大型可视化数据库,包含上千万张图片和上万个类别,可用于训练深度神经网络。COCO数据集针对图像识别、目标检测、语义分割等任务提供的大型数据集,包含丰富的标注信息和多种类别的目标。WikiText用于自然语言处理任务的大型文本数据集,包含文章、新闻、故事等多种文本类型,可用于训练语言模型、文本分类等任务。公开数据集简介和使用方法常用编程工具和框架推荐TensorFlow由Google开发的开源深度学习框架,支持分布式训练、多种硬件加速以及丰富的算法库和工具。PyTorch由Facebook开发的动态图深度学习框架,易于使用和调试,支持GPU加速和自定义扩展。Keras基于TensorFlow或Theano的高级神经网络API,提供简洁易用的接口和丰富的预训练模型。使用技巧选择合适的编程工具和框架需要考虑任务需求、硬件环境、个人习惯等多方面因素,同时需要掌握相应的编程技能和调试能力。输入标题StackOverflowGitHub在线资源和社区交流平台全球最大的代码托管平台之一,提供Git版本控制、代码托管、

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论